【Java】final关键字&权限修饰符&内部类&引用类型用法(一)
1. final关键字1.1 概述学习了继承后,我们知道,子类可以在父类的基础上改写父类内容,比如,方法重写。那么我们能不能随意的继承API 中提供的类,改写其内容呢?显然这是不合适的。为了避免这种随意改写的情况, Java 提供了final 关键字,用于修饰 不可改变 内容。fifinal : 不可改变。可以用于修饰类、方法和变量。类:被修饰的类,不能被继承。方法:被修饰的方法,不能被重写。变....
Java类的概念|包括封装、继承、多态|以及成员方法、权限修饰符、this关键字等类的相关的概念知识|Java必学知识点
博主昵称:Jovy. 博客主页:Jovy.的博客感谢点赞评论⚇很方便的在线编辑器:Lightly让我们一起在写作中记录学习吧!编辑目录 前言什么是类?我对类的理解类的继承、封装、多态类的封装 类的继承 类的多态成员方法、权限修饰符、this关键字成员方法权限修饰符this关键字第一种作用第二种作用 文末总结 前言Java是一个专门的面向对象的语言,在现在还是受到很多人的喜爱,Java工程师是招聘....
Java权限修饰符(包括Java8 default介绍)
权限修饰符概述在Java中提供了四种访问权限,使用不同的访问权限修饰符修饰时,被修饰的内容会有不同的访问权限,public:公共的。protected:受保护的default:默认的private:私有的不同权限的访问能力可见,public具有最大权限。private则是最小权限。编写代码时,如果没有特殊的考虑,建议这样使用权限:成员变量使用 private ,隐藏细节。构造方法使用 publi....
java学习之高级语法(六)----- final关键字、权限修饰符、内部类
final关键字final 关键字代表最终、不可改变的。final 常见的四种用法: 1.可以用来修饰一个类 格式: public final class 类名称{ ....
八、JavaSE进阶之【Java 包机制与访问权限修饰符】。
第一章:包机制和import1.1包机制包其实就是目录,特别是项目比较大,java 文件特别多的情况下,我们应该分目录管理,在 java中称为分包管理,包名称通常采用小写。重点:1、包最好采用小写字母2、包的命名应该有规则,不能重复,一般采用公司网站逆序,如:com.xxxxx.项目名称.模块名称com.xxxx.exam3.package 必须放到 所有语句的第一行,注释除外代码演示:pack....
面试官竟然还问我 Java 权限修饰符,一时不知道怎么回答。。。
大家好,我是鸭哥。昨天鸭哥在微信群里,看到一个面试者诉苦,说自己面试时被提问权限修饰符的相关知识,要求说出 public、protected、default(无修饰符,即package private) 和 private 的区别,结果他只能根据单词的字面意思说个大概,面试官的态度迅速就冷淡了。面试前,没能把握好这类基础知识,他追悔莫及。鸭哥想说,权限修饰符虽然是基础知识,但是怎么合理恰当地运用....
Java SE基础知识详解第[8]期—面向对象进阶(包、权限修饰符、抽象类、接口)
面向对象进阶(包、权限修饰符、抽象类、接口)1.包什么是包?包是用来分门别类的管理各种不同类的,类似于文件夹、建包利于程序的管理和维护。建包的语法格式:package 公司域名倒写.技术名称。包名全部英文小写且有意义。建包语句必须在第一行,一般IDEA工具会帮助创建导包相同包下的类可以直接访问,不同包下的类必须导包才可以使用。导包格式:import 包名.类名;若一个类中需要用到不同包下的两个同....
Java中4种权限修饰符的范围
Java规定的4种权限(从小到大排列):private、缺省、protected 、public4种权限都可以用来修饰类的内部结构:属性、方法、构造器、内部类 即如下表:修饰符内部类同一个包不同包的子类同一个工程privateyesdefault(缺省)yesyesprotectedyesyesyespublicyesyesyesyes 修饰类的话,只能使用:default(缺省)、public....
Java基础——package+权限修饰符+内部类
packagepackage就是文件夹,将字节码(.class)进行分类存放 。包的注意事项:包的写法:package 包名package语句必须是程序的第一条可执行的代码package语句在一个java文件中只能有一个如果没有package,默认表示无包名带包的类的编译和运行编译:在D盘下有Person_Test.java ,在D盘下打开dos命令行执行 javac -d . Person_T....
Java中,权限修饰符的权限测试
============================================================================= 1、 1 /* 2 权限修饰符的权限测试: 3 4 权限修饰符 本类中 同一个包下的子类和无关类 不同包下的子类 不同包下的无关类 5 privat...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注